Bergamo, located in northern Italy, offers a blend of historical charm and natural beauty. One of the most notable attractions is the Città Alta, or Upper Town, which features medieval architecture and cobblestone streets. Here, visitors can explore the Piazza Vecchia, a central square surrounded by significant buildings like the Palazzo della Ragione and the Campanone, which provides panoramic views of the surrounding area.
Another important site is the Basilica di Santa Maria Maggiore, renowned for its stunning interior and historical significance. Nearby, the Colleoni Chapel showcases exquisite Renaissance art and architecture. For those interested in local culture, the Accademia Carrara houses an impressive collection of Italian Renaissance paintings.
For outdoor enthusiasts, the surrounding hills offer various hiking trails and parks, such as the Parco dei Colli, which provide opportunities for nature walks and scenic views. Additionally, the Funicular ride from the lower town to the upper town is a pleasant experience, offering unique perspectives of the landscape.
Culinary experiences in Bergamo should not be overlooked. The local cuisine features dishes such as polenta e osei, a traditional dish that reflects the region’s agricultural heritage. Exploring local markets and trattorias can provide a taste of authentic Bergamasque flavors.
Finally, visiting the Castello di San Vigilio can enhance your experience, as it combines historical intrigue with breathtaking vistas of the city and the surrounding countryside. Overall, Bergamo presents a rich tapestry of experiences that cater to a variety of interests.
